Our client is seeking a dedicated and compassionate psychiatrist to join their ACT Team two days a week. The ACT Psychiatrist plays a vital role in delivering community-based psychiatric care to adults living with serious and persistent mental illness. This position offers the opportunity to make a significant impact through person-centered care in a supportive team environment.
Key Responsibilities:
- Provide psychiatric assessment, diagnosis, and ongoing medication management to ACT clients in the community and/or clinic setting
-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team including nurses, social workers, case managers, peer specialists, and substance use counselors
- Participate in daily team meetings and treatment planning sessions
- Monitor client progress, ensure continuity of care, and update treatment plans as needed
- Respond to urgent psychiatric needs and provide crisis intervention support
- Ensure documentation is timely, accurate, and meets regulatory standards
- Provide consultation and education to ACT team members regarding psychiatric issues
- Maintain compliance with local, state, and federal regulations and standards of care
Qualifications:
- MD or DO with a valid license to practice medicine in New York State
- Board certified or board eligible in Psychiatry
- DEA license and current Controlled Substance Registration
- Experience working with individuals with serious mental illness, preferably in a community-based or ACT model setting
- Strong commitment to recovery-oriented and trauma-informed care
- Excellent communication, collaboration, and organizational skills
